About

Zahra Hami is a scholar working on Biomaterials, Biomedical Engineering and Cancer Research. According to data from OpenAlex, Zahra Hami has authored 21 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Biomaterials, 4 papers in Biomedical Engineering and 4 papers in Cancer Research. Recurrent topics in Zahra Hami’s work include Graphene and Nanomaterials Applications (4 papers), Nanoparticle-Based Drug Delivery (4 papers) and Nanoplatforms for cancer theranostics (3 papers). Zahra Hami is often cited by papers focused on Graphene and Nanomaterials Applications (4 papers), Nanoparticle-Based Drug Delivery (4 papers) and Nanoplatforms for cancer theranostics (3 papers). Zahra Hami collaborates with scholars based in Iran. Zahra Hami's co-authors include Mohsen Amini, Mahmoud Ghazi‐Khansari, Kambiz Gilani, Seyed Mahdi Rezayat, Abdolazim Alinejad, Nezam Mirzaei, Mehdi Vosoughi, Hamideh Bahrami, Anvar Asadi and Mohammad Reza Zare and has published in prestigious journals such as Nanotechnology, Colloids and Surfaces B Biointerfaces and Journal of Molecular Liquids.
